There will be 36 squares in the 8th step of the pattern
<h3>How to determine the number of squares?</h3>
The pattern and the squares are represented as:
<u>Pattern Squares</u>
1 1
2 3
3 6
4 10
This can be rewritten as:
<u>Pattern Squares</u>
1 1
2 1 + 2
3 1 + 2 +3
4 1 + 2 + 3 +4
So, the number of squares on the 8th pattern is:
8th pattern = 1 + 2 + 3 +4 + 5 + 6 + 7 + 8
Evaluate
8th pattern = 36
Hence, there will be 36 squares in the 8th step

Answer:
(x - 43)(x + 3)
Step-by-step explanation:
consider the factors of the constant term (- 129) which sum to give the coefficient of the x- term (- 40)
the factors are - 43 and + 3 , since
- 43 × + 3 = - 129 and - 43 + 3 = - 40 , then
x² - 40x - 129 = (x - 43)(x + 3) ← in factored form
